The iMocha integration will allow you to send iMocha assessments directly from the Lever candidate opportunity.
Setting up the iMocha integration
- In iMocha, navigate to Settings > Integration > Lever > Configure
- Click on the Authorize button as shown below:
- After clicking Authorize, you will be redirect to log into Lever
- Once you login, you'll be redirected to iMocha to configure the integration
Configuring the iMocha integration
- In iMocha, select the 'Assessment Stage' in which you want the integration to trigger upon candidate entry
- Select the 'Assessment Complete Stage' in which you want the candidate moved to following assessment completion; this movement will happen automatically through the integration.
- Select the profile form template from the dropdown and choose 'iMocha Assessment'; if this is not yet created, click the plus sign to create it
- To sync and create tags in Lever, select a job posting from the dropdown and select the candidate for which you would like to create your assessment package tags
- We recommend creating a sample candidate that will hold all of the available package tags.
- Once all fields are selected click Save
- Click the Activate Integration button
Using the iMocha integration
- Add a package label as a tag on the candidate's opportunity
- Move the opportunity to the configured assessment trigger stage
- The candidate will receive an email from iMocha
- Once the test is completed, you will find the candidate in the configured assessment completion stage
- Assessment details will be added as a form on the opportunity
- An assessment report file will also be uploaded to the candidate profile upon completion
Disabling the iMocha integration
- In Lever navigate to Settings > Integrations and API
- Under the 'Authorized Apps' tab, locate the iMocha API credentials
- Click the trash can icon to disable the integration
